Event: 12/03/1999
Employee sustained fractured hip and elbow in fall from roof

On December 3, 1999, Employee #1 sustained a fractured right hip and right elbow when he fell approximately 18 ft from the roof of a residence while performing roofing activities. Employee #1 was hospitalized.
